1)
The Psychos were early 1980’s punk/hardcore band from New York. Band’s bass player Billy Milano later became famous as singer of S.O.D. and M.O.D.

2)
The Psychos were formed in S.E London in early 1977 by Clive Goodman (vocals),Cliff Whittle (guitar) and Dave Jenkins (bass) +various drummers. They recorded a session in october 1977 for Raw records which featured four tracks, Soul train, Straitjacket, So young and Young, British and White. They play a number of gigs supporting Slaughter and the dogs and Motörhead and once had Iggy Pop join them on stage at Soho's Roxy club.

3)
The Psychos is an adventure which has taken its beginning in spring 2002. Johnny and Micky - after the split of their hard rock band Wild Charm from Trentino - wanted to form a new band based in Bolzano and playing a rougher and straighter sound. Within less weeks Rufio (ex-Feedback) joined the band as the perfect drummer for The Psychos. The chemistry was good from the beginning and the project became more and more concrete after some dynamic concerts and the release of the first demo in the end of 2003. People and journalists liked the demo and the band remained surprised.
In the meantime Johnny, Micky and Rufio were looking for a new member. They rehearsed with some different guitarists, until they choose Vince as their fourth and final member. He joined The Psychos in 2004, just on time to play his part on the second mini-cd called Injection! which was released in 2005 on the label Kornalcielo from Treviso. In this period the band played their most intensive (and most mad) live gigs, but the band-lineup couldn’t stand - typically for rock'n'roll! Vince left the band shortly after the release of their first CD The Devil's Kiss, released in the end of 2006 on San Martin Records from Turin. The feedback for the album was good and so the band continued its live activity as a trio without big problems.
After another year full of gigs, the The Psychos did their next record. But this time they tried to spend more work and time on it: the live activities were reduced to a minimum and the band worked on new songs evening after evening. This way to work and the very "free" character of the band caused countless delays. However, in the end of 2009 the final result was ready to hit the streets and backyards: Blood Sweat Rock'n'Roll, released by Airbagpromo Records. .
